## Summary

Scottish Enterprise is seeking a commercial property adviser for strategic acquisition advice on a large brownfield industrial site in Grangemouth. The work covers real estate consultancy, including non-residential property services and land management advice, to support a potential acquisition and the associated commercial property decisions. The procurement is for services and is centred on Grangemouth, with Scottish Enterprise as the buying organisation. The requirement is relevant to firms advising on industrial land, brownfield redevelopment, property acquisition, valuation, land management or related commercial property transactions. The successful adviser will support Scottish Enterprise rather than deliver construction or remediation works, so businesses whose role is primarily construction, engineering or physical site operations may find the scope less relevant.

The procurement has reached tender: Scottish Enterprise invited offers through an open procedure, with electronic submission. Bids must be submitted by 19 October 2026 at 11:00 BST; bids are opened and the award period begins at that time. The estimated contract value is £200,000. The contract is stated as lasting 1,080 days, with an anticipated initial 12-month term and options for Scottish Enterprise to extend it by two further 12-month periods. Bids must remain valid for 90 days, and variants are not permitted. The requirement is a single lot. Responses must be in English, electronic ordering and electronic payment will be used, and electronic invoicing is permitted. Participation may be excluded under Regulation 58 of the Public Contracts (Scotland) Regulations 2015.

This opportunity suits established commercial property consultancies with experience of advising on strategic acquisitions of industrial or brownfield land. Relevant capability includes commercial property advice, acquisition strategy, land and property appraisal, due diligence, negotiation support and land management. The buyer requires bidders to provide the names and professional qualifications of staff assigned to the work, so suppliers should have a suitably qualified and identifiable project team rather than relying only on general corporate credentials. Bidders must also complete and return the required Climate Change Plan template, making demonstrated understanding of climate responsibilities relevant to participation. The work is substantial enough for firms able to support a public-sector client through a strategic property acquisition, while specialist property advisers may be well placed to compete.
